Strategic risk refers to the potential for losses or negative outcomes that can arise from a company's strategy, including decisions regarding resource allocation, market positioning, and long-term goals. It highlights the uncertainty associated with pursuing certain strategic initiatives and the possible consequences of those choices on an organization's overall success. Understanding strategic risk is crucial as it impacts both the analysis of potential uncertainties and the ongoing monitoring and control of risks throughout the execution of a business strategy.
